Structural Volume Changes upon Photoisomerization: A Laser-Induced Optoacoustic Study with a Water-Soluble Nitrostilbene
作者:Ingolf Michler、Alessandro Feis、Miguel A. Rodríguez、Silvia E. Braslavsky
DOI:10.1021/jp004334m
日期:2001.5.1
The trans to cis photoisomerization of 4,4‘-dinitro-2,2‘-disulfonylstilbene (DS) was studied by laser-induced optoacoustic spectroscopy (LIOAS) in aereated neat water and in aereated aqueous solutions of various monovalent cations (NH4+, N(CH3)4+, Na+, K+, and Cs+) and the respective cis to trans photoisomerization only in the presence of NH4+.
